Encore Azalea Empress Monarch fall color

Encores are wonderful, repeat blooming, perennial, evergreen shrubs. I amend the sandy soil in the Central Florida sandhills and the Encores do fine without regular irrigation. They may get hose water once a month from April to June when the summer rainy season starts. I even had three Encores burn to the ground in April 2020. They took 6 months to re-sprout from the roots and did flower by January and February of 2021.

Nothing comes close to the durability, low-maintenance or long-term beauty of an Encore Azalea.

The one variety that stands head and shoulders above the rest is Encore Azalea Autumn Lilac™. Although it was bred primarily for cold hardiness, Autumn Lilac thrives in the heat and humidity of Florida. The lilac flowers with darker freckles bloom continuously September –January on rounded shrubs to 24” tall. In five years we have never pruned it, and the dark, emerald green foliage looks great year ‘round.”

“Our Encore Azaleas produce consistent flowers year-round especially when planted in more sun. We have also found that they are significantly more resistant to lace bug when compared to other azaleas that we are growing. The Encore Azaleas are very hardy for Western Oregon, take low maintenance, and we give them high marks on overall performance.”

“I have been growing the Encore Azaleas for over 15 years along with over 400 other azalea varieties. My Encore Azaleas have done as well as any azalea, but over the years have bloomed consistently in the fall. I am in a zone 6, and this past winter we had two days of negative 5 degrees with no snow cover, and most all of my Encore Azaleas have come back strong.”
